Why Does Jesus Want Us to Have Fun and Enjoy Life Even Amid Difficulty - WWJD.org

Today, we're diving into a question at the heart of Christian living: Why would Jesus want us to enjoy life, even amid difficulty?"<br /><br />You know, life is full of struggles, responsibilities, and moments when it feels like everything is weighing us down. But here's something powerful—Jesus actually calls us to experience joy, not just in the good times, but in all times. In John 15:11, Jesus said, 'I have told you this so that my joy may be in you and that your joy may be complete.' His message is clear: joy is at the core of His teachings."<br /><br />And this joy isn’t just about having a trouble-free life. It’s about finding peace and contentment, knowing that God’s love transcends the challenges we face. Today, we’ll explore how Jesus’ emphasis on joy, rest, community, and childlike faith can help us balance the highs and lows of life. So whether you're juggling family, work, or just trying to catch your breath in this busy world—this episode is for you."<br /><br />Let’s unpack how we can live with that lighthearted joy, and why embracing fun isn’t just a luxury—it’s part of a faithful life.
